can you put a 2001 pontiac grand prix gtp engine into a 2002 grand prix gtp

I have a 2002 pontiac grand prix gtp with a blown engine and I was wondering if I could put a 2001 grand prix gtp engine into it.

Should convert just fine. The body and mounting locations and bellhousing to tranny will all be the same, as there weren't any real design changes between the 01 and 02 GP.
